If the idea turns out to be promising, it could become the basis for a larger program., Disruptioneering awards are limited to $1 million and an 18-month period of performance. Disruptioneering programs will follow a standard format: a three- to six-month first phase to initially assess a novel idea, potentially followed by a second phase of 12 to 15 months, if results from the first phase warrant further exploration and investment. For this new Disruptioneering effort, the time from program announcement to when research proposals are due has been shortened to as few as 30 days, and the technical section of proposals cant exceed eight pages, said Kristen Fuller, DSOs assistant director for program management.
